Encourage your students to visit the AP Physics C: Electricity and Magnetism student page for exam information.We can refer to the AP® Student Score Distributions, released annually by the College Board. These reports show us that the mean score was 3.51 in 2014, 3.44 in 2015, 3.51 in 2016, 3.49 in 2017, 3.60 in 2018, 3.60 in 2019 and 3.68 in 2020. This gives us a score of 3.55 when we calculate the raw averages for the previous seven years.

Scores on the free-response questions and performance assessments are weighted and combined with the results of the computer-scored multiple-choice questions, and this raw score is converted into a composite AP score on a 1-5 scale. AP Exams are not norm-referenced or graded on a curve.Attach the spring to a wall horizontally. Push a block into the spring, compressing the spring a displacement D. The AP Physics 1 Exam consists of the following sections: Section I: Multiple Choice. 50 multiple choice questions (1 hour, 30 minutes), 50% of exam score. Section II: Free Response. 5 free-response questions (1 hour, 30 minutes), 50% of exam score.
